Transaction 4ecf72bd31743095475b2939ddc5096ae8930fee812e8fdf028238b4dbe188d2
1 Input
1 Output
-
4ecf72bd31743095475b2939ddc5096ae8930fee812e8fdf028238b4dbe188d2:0
- value
- 581397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5cccfbee395095ab050d85503eeb971848050e93 OP_EQUAL
- address
- 3A9hejimR2z7iCkVRiKoXnArKUNgoiLxX8